An Organic Micro Farm: Sustainable Abundance in Small Spaces
Urban citizens are discovering the magic of cultivating their own food right in their tiny spaces. Micro farming, a practice that embraces sustainable methods and compact layouts, is proving to be an effective way to produce fresh, organic produce even in the most confined areas.
Tiny plots of land can be implemented on rooftops, balconies, or even within urban dwellings. Utilizing techniques such as vertical cultivation, hydroponics, and composting, these plots transform into miniature ecosystems teeming with life. The perks of micro farming are abundant.
Beyond providing a source of fresh, healthy food, micro farms play a role in reducing our carbon footprint, promoting biodiversity, and fostering a deeper relationship with nature.
By means of the principles of permaculture and organic farming practices, micro farms aim to create a closed-loop system that mimics the natural world. This method not only produces bountiful harvests but also stimulates responsible stewardship of our planet's resources for future generations.
Tiny Gardens, Big Yields: Mastering Small Space Gardening
Don't let a small space stop you from enjoying the rewards of gardening. With a little forethought, even the most diminutive yards can yield a surprising harvest of fresh, homegrown produce and beautiful flowers. Start by identifying the right plants for your region, and consider raised beds to maximize your growing space.
- Leverage sunlight effectively by placing plants where they'll receive the most hours of direct sun.
- Group plants with similar watering needs together to simplify your maintenance.
- Swap crops regularly to avoid soil depletion and pests
With some resourcefulness, you can convert your small space into a thriving green haven.
